I have one chick that has a crusty navel, it is not infected or anything and she is doing great however my past experience in having a white chick with a navel like this ends up getting pecked and can result in their death , i don't want to put her by herself even in the pen because it will stress her.

I tried paper tape to cover it up but they are a bit waterproof at this age and it would not stick, so anyone wanna throw some ideas as to how i could camouflage the navel till it falls out on it's own

I buy a product that is or about is what was called in last post blu kote .. It is sold here as blue lotion.... and is dark violet, I works very good on pecking problems open cuts about any damage to a chicken or peafowl. I helps heal and the color stays forever and the other birds do not bother the bird with this on it . It will stain what ever you get it on. I have used it for over 30 yrs and always have some on hand .. you cant beat it for feather picking or even open holes from picking problems.. connerhills
